Debris Flows are a distinct type of landslide that suddenly occur without warning. They are fast-moving channels of water and soil that carry large natural objects like boulders and trees, or human-made objects including cars. In the American West, Debris Flows have directly caused death and property damage. Debris Flows often occur after rain events and the burn scars left behind by wildfires increase their likelihood. Given the increasing frequency of extreme weather events, it is critical to predict Debris Flows and take precautionary action before they occur. This project builds upon prior research of predicting Debris Flows using additional geological features and more advanced machine learning techniques. The project also includes an intuitive interface for decision makers to access these probability estimates.
